The Spending Spree: Does Money Guarantee Success?
Chelsea’s transfer strategy has been one of the biggest talking points in football. Under new ownership, they have spent over £1 billion on players in just a few transfer windows. However, spending big does not always translate into success.
Many of the players brought in have failed to make an impact, and the squad lacks cohesion. Manchester City, under Guardiola, has spent wisely, ensuring that each player fits into his tactical system. Chelsea’s reckless spending, without a clear footballing identity, has only added to their woes.
Managerial Chaos: A Key Factor in Chelsea’s Decline
One of the biggest differences between Manchester City and Chelsea is managerial stability. Guardiola has been at City since 2016, creating a legacy of success. Chelsea, on the other hand, has had over 10 different managers in the same period.
The frequent managerial changes mean that the team constantly adapts to different tactics, leading to inconsistency. Players struggle to settle, and new managers often have different visions for the squad. This lack of continuity has severely affected Chelsea’s performances on the pitch.
